alloc 问答列表

如何在Cython中将大型malloc'd数组返回或保存为Python对象?

作者:Emalude 提问时间:10/26/2021

我想使用 Cython 从模型创建大量模拟样本,稍后需要使用 Python 进行分析。运行一次模拟脚本的结果应该是 10000 x 10000 数组。 我已经定义了一个函数,并试图将我的数组声明为 ...

C:对于一个小结构,返回结构还是返回对结构的引用?[关闭]

作者:Sasha 提问时间:9/14/2023

已关闭。这个问题是基于意见的。它目前不接受答案。 想改进这个问题吗?更新问题,以便可以通过编辑这篇文章用事实和引文来回答。 2个月前关闭。 改进此问题 在 C 中; 如果结构很小,因为它主要...

malloc:检测到堆损坏,空闲列表已损坏

作者:Tapas Pal 提问时间:9/13/2019

我的应用程序在iOS 12之前运行良好。将我的 iOS 版本更新到 iOS 13 测试版后,该应用程序在随机位置崩溃并出现相同的错误。以下是 Xcode 控制台。 MyApp(618,0x10ceb...

如何从 stdlib 取消定义 calloc() 函数以使用我们自己的函数

作者:Himanshu 提问时间:9/12/2023

我有一个头文件 calloc.h,我在其中使用 stdlib 的 malloc() 函数定义了 calloc() 函数。但是我遇到了错误。multiple definition of 'calloc'...

程序运行,但 Valgrind 在尝试写入 malloc 的内存时检测到问题

作者:Roger Dodger 提问时间:9/12/2023

为了学习更多 C,我正在尝试重新创建基本数据结构。这是我尝试使用数组的最小示例,该数组可以编译并运行,但 valgrind 检测到问题: #include <stdlib.h> #include <...

我怎样才能同时返回和释放内存

作者:Alper Tangil 提问时间:7/20/2023

我有一个函数,可以分配内存,然后用数据填充它,然后返回它。 我想释放这个分配的内存,但是如果我在返回之前释放它,它将返回 null,如果我尝试在返回后释放,因为函数在看到返回时结束,它不会释放。 ...

动态内存分配和指针

作者:DM10 提问时间:9/9/2023

我正在为指针及其分配而苦苦挣扎。 我想知道我是否正确分配,否则应该如何完成。 此外,我收到有关 fgets 和 put 函数的警告,但我认为这与错误的分配有关。 #include <stdio.h>...

发生异常,在 c 中使用 free() 时出现分段错误;

作者:Nishu Patel 提问时间:9/6/2023

我的代码以某种方式运行,但它没有给出预期的结果,所以为了理解它,我开始调试,它显示发生了异常,我使用的行出现了分段错误。 这是我的代码:free() struct stack { char ch;...

为什么当 malloc 尺寸这么大时访问内存错误?

作者:Tom 提问时间:9/8/2023

正如你所看到的,当我运行它时,我遇到了内存访问错误。 我将malloc_size更改为 100,它可以工作。如何在不更改malloc_size的情况下修复它。 int malloc_size = 9...

C++程序核心转储,因为新的 &lt;string 内存大小巨大&gt;

作者:Steven 提问时间:9/8/2023

我的程序报告了核心转储回跟踪,如下所示: 0000000011deaae2 MEMalloc_fail 110 /home/jenkins/workspace/shared/memory/MEMlo...


共403条 当前第15页